Gold Prices Decline Amid U.S.-Iran Exchange of Fire in Persian Gulf

Gold prices held losses following reports of military exchanges between the U.S. and Iran in the Persian Gulf on Monday. The incident threatens a four-week-old ceasefire in the region. It also raises potential risks for inflation.

Gold Prices Decline as US-Iran Peace Talks Stall Amid Ongoing War

Gold prices edged lower following stalled efforts to resume peace talks between the United States and Iran. The development occurs two months into a war that has disrupted global markets. The conflict has also contributed to increased risks of inflation.

RBI Highlights Second-Round Inflation Risks from Mideast Conflict

The Reserve Bank of India has noted potential second-round inflation risks if the Mideast war persists. Deputy Governor Gupta expressed this view in an interview with ET. The comments reflect concerns about economic effects from geopolitical tensions in the region.
